FireHawk Specifications

Specification FireHawk
Power Output 5300W
Actual Power Consumption 2747W
Wavelengths 630nm, 660nm, 850nm
Weight 108kg
Cooling System High-quality low-noise fan for enhanced heat dissipation
Recommended Usage Distance 30-80cm
Recommended Session Duration 15-20 minutes

Precautions & Safety Guidelines

Important Safety Information

  • Waterproof Considerations:

    • The FireHawk is not waterproof. Avoid exposure to water, moisture, or steam.
  • Optimal Working Environment:

    • Temperature Range: -20°C to 40°C
    • Humidity Level: 45%-95% RH
  • Installation & Electrical Safety:

    • Avoid placing near heat sources, hot steam, or corrosive gases.
    • Device must be installed by a professional electrician for safety.
    • Use a three-plug, American-standard 3m 3-core 2.5 square copper wire capable of withstanding 3300W power.
    • A separate power socket line (supporting 3300W or more) is highly recommended.
  • General Safety Warnings:

    • Always wear the provided blackout goggles when using the device.
    • Do not knock, hit, or move the device while in operation.
    • Cut off power during thunderstorms to avoid electrical damage.
    • Unauthorized disassembly may lead to device damage or malfunction.
